Bangalore , July 13, 2006: Indiagames, India's No.1 online and mobile games company launched its revolutionary new service - Games on Demand with Airtel Broadband & telephone Services, India's largest private broadband and telephone service provider in the capital today. The service was launched with cricketing maestro Sachin Tendulkar playing an online rally game.       

This service offers unlimited consumption of legal games at a bare minimum monthly subscription fee of just Rs. 199. Indiagames has partnered with a number of leading games publishers like Microsoft, Atari, Playfirst, Alawar, Merscomm, Cenega, Meridian, Techland, amongst others, to be able to bring a variety of premium single and multiplayer games, which include popular titles such as Age of Empires, Driv3R and Flight Simulator to this service.
